Home
By: JULIE ANDREWS
Julie Andrews has never before revealed the true story of her childhood and upbringing. In HOME she vividly recreates the years before the movies. The family moved to London, and there are vivid scenes of life during the Blitz. Her stepfather encouraged her to have singing lessons. By the time she was a teenager, she was supporting her whole family with her singing. A London Palladium pantomime led to a leading role in THE BOYFRIEND on Broadway at 19. Parts in MY FAIR LADY opposite Rex Harrison and CAMELOT with Richard Burton soon followed. HOME is an honest, touching and revealing memoir of the early life of a true icon.

Book Choice
The Calorie, Carb and Fat Bible
By: LYNDEL COSTAIN, JULIETTE KELLOW, REBECCA WALTON
This brand new edition of the UK’s most comprehensive calorie counter gives calorie, protein, carbohydrate, fat and fibre content for over 22,000 UK brands and basics. Tables and charts show how many calories individuals need, and how many calories are burned during popular exercises, as well as showing body mass index and healthy weight ranges. There is also a photocopiable food and exercise diary page, a personal plan, and advice for eating healthily.
